WebExample 2: A 0.010 M solution of hydrochloric acid, HCl, has a molarity of 0.010 M. +This means that [H ] = 1 x 10-2 M. The pH of this aqueous solution of H+ ions is pH = 2. You will notice that the pH number is just the positive exponent of 10 from the Molar concentration. A less-concentrated solution of [H +] = 0.0001 M gives us [H ] = 1 x 10 ...

WebIn this problem, a 10 - 10 M solution of HCl contributes 10 - 10 M [H + ]. The ionization of water contributes 10 - 7 M [H + ]. The effective [H +] of this solution is 10 - 7 M and the pH=7.
